High Power Bidirectional DC Motor Driver using IFX007T

This motor driver circuit can drive a brushed DC motor with up to 250W of continuous load. The project can be controlled with the general logic IO-Ports of any microcontroller. Either an Arduino Uno or another microcontroller can be used as the control board. The project uses two IFX007T IC from Infineon. Each IC provides half-bridge operation featuring one P-channel high side MOSFET and one N-channel low side MOSFET with an integrated driver IC. The IFX007T half-bridge is easy to control by applying logic level signals to the IN and INH pin. When applying a PWM to the IN pin the current provided to the motor can be controlled with the duty cycle of the PWM. With external R6, R9 resistors connected between the SR pin and GND you can set the slew rate of the power switches. The Motor Control board can be easily connected to any Arduino board or microcontroller via headers.

Features

  • Brushed DC Motor Control up to 250 W continuous load
  • Motor Supply 8 – 24 V nominal input voltage (max. 6 – 40 V)
  • Average motor current 30 A restricted due to the limited power dissipation of the PCB (IFX007T current limitation @ 55 A min.)
  • Drives one brushed bi-directional DC motor
  • Capable of high-frequency PWM, e.g. 25 kHz
  • Adjustable slew rates for optimized EMI by changing external resistor R6, R9
  • Driver circuit with logic level inputs
  • Status flag diagnosis with current sense capability
  • Protection e.g. against over-temperature and overcurrent
  • PCB dimensions: 49.82 x 44.62 mm

The IFX007T is an integrated high current half bridge for motor drive applications. It is part of the Industrial & Multi-Purpose Nova lithic™ family containing one p-channel high-side MOSFET and one n-channel low-side MOSFET with an integrated driver IC in one package. Due to the p-channel high-side switch the need for a charge pump is eliminated thus minimizing EMI. Interfacing to a microcontroller is made easy by the integrated driver IC which features logic level inputs, diagnosis with current sense, slew rate adjustment, dead time generation and protection against over temperature, under voltage, overcurrent and short circuit. The IFX007T provides a cost optimized solution for protected high current PWM motor drives with very low board space consumption.
